Analysis of the level of burden in caregivers of children with heart disease

Abstract

Objective

to correlate the characteristics of children with congenital heart disease with the level of burden of their primary caregivers.

Methods

This was a cross-sectional study with a quantitative approach. Data was collected through online interviews with 100 primary caregiver mothers of children with congenital heart disease. They answered the child characterization instrument and the Zarit Burden Interview. The data was analyzed using SPSS version 23, using descriptive statistics and analysis of variance (p≤0.05).

Results

The average age of the children was 3.9 years, with a standard deviation of 3.2 years, with a prevalence of males (58.0%) and cyanotic heart disease (51.0%), under specialized cardiology care (96.0%), using regular medication (55.0%), without hospitalization in the last 12 months (56.0%) and having undergone at least one surgery (44.0%). Specialized follow-up (p=0.003), the presence of comorbidities (p=0.0001) and attending daycare or school (p=0.001) were associated with a higher risk of overload.

Conclusion

The correlation of the characteristics of children with heart disease indicated a slight burden on their primary caregivers. Children with specialized care, comorbidities and who attend school or daycare increased the burden on their caregivers.

Introduction

Congenital heart diseases are defects in the structure of the heart and great vessels that usually develop during the embryonic period. There is no clear etiology. However, heart defects can be associated with genetic factors, chromosomal alterations, maternal age, use of medication during pregnancy, etc. They are among the most common malformations at birth and affect eight out of every thousand live births in Brazil and 94 out of every ten thousand live births worldwide.(11. In Brazil, 28,900 children with congenital heart disease (CHD) are born every year, corresponding to 1% of all births. Of these, around 23,800 (80.0%) children require surgical intervention, half of them in the first twelve months of life. Congenital heart defects can be identified in utero and prenatal care, delivery and birth should take place in more technologically dense locations, with birth planned in units with adequate infrastructure to provide intensive neonatal and surgical care. In this way, transporting the newborn after birth is avoided and surgical and intensive neonatal care is promoted, with a positive impact on quality indicators through access to a specialized and experienced multi-professional team. These care strategies increase the possibility of survival, reduce complications, increase safety and quality, thus improving the prognosis of these newborns.(44. Binsfeld L, Gomes MA, Kuschnir R. These children have special health needs during pregnancy, birth and the postpartum period. These needs are characterized by the continuous use of medication, dependence on life-sustaining technologies (due to examinations and surgical interventions), more restricted monitoring of their growth and development, as well as changes in daily habits. In international literature, they are identified and classified as Children with Health Special Care Needs. In Brazil, this expression has been translated and adapted to Children with Special Health Care Needs (CRIANES), as the use of health services and multi-professional care (including nursing) by such children is broader than that of other children.(55. Children with congenital heart disease have different care demands to be met by health professionals and family members. In the context of family care, the health complexity imposed by congenital heart disease places a heavy burden on the primary caregiver. The primary caregiver is the person with the main, total or greatest responsibility for caring for the child, without remuneration for doing so, and may or may not be a family member.(88. In the literature, the primary caregiver’s burden is approached from the objective and subjective aspects. The former is related to changes in routine, impacts on social, professional and financial life, performing different tasks, as well as the need to monitor behavior in order to prevent health problems for the person being cared for. The subjective aspects are related to the caregiver’s perception of their situation, including guilt, anger, expectations and positive and negative thoughts.(99. Therefore, the aim of this study was to correlate the characteristics of children with congenital heart disease with the level of burden of their primary caregivers.

Methods

This is a cross-sectional, descriptive and exploratory study with a quantitative approach. To write the manuscript, the Strengthening the Reporting of Observational Studies in Epidemiology (STROBE) guidelines were followed. Data was collected in Brazil in the form of an online interview, carried out in an environment of the participant’s choice between June 2021 and February 2022.

For the selection of participants, the following items were considered as eligibility criteria: being the primary caregiver of children, from zero to less than 12 years of age, with congenital heart disease and being over 18 years of age. The exclusion criterion was: being a caregiver without an electronic device with a camera available.

Participants were recruited from interest groups on a virtual social network aimed at family members and caregivers of children with congenital heart disease. Seven groups were identified. They were selected by title, searching in a social network tool (magnifying glass) with two keywords: congenital heart disease and children with congenital heart disease. In the closed groups, the researcher contacted the administrator and asked for access to participate. After gaining access, the first contact was made by publicizing the research using a standard text introducing the researcher and a summary (objectives and eligibility criteria) of the research.

Caregivers who expressed an interest in the research and met the inclusion criteria identified themselves as the child’s primary caregiver, filled in a link (Google Forms®) sent by the researcher and provided their e-mail address and telephone number. During the initial contact with the participants, the researcher introduced herself and explained the objectives and development of the research. She then invited the primary caregivers to take part in the research and informed them that the interview would be recorded.

The study population comprised primary caregivers of children with congenital heart disease, with non-randomized convenience sampling. After the invitation, 130 people showed interest in taking part in the study. These included people who refused to take part via video call (5), did not get back to the researcher (10), did not have access to the camera for the video call (2), were not primary caregivers (1), and whose children were over twelve years old (4), were hospitalized at the time (7), died during the week of the interview (1). Thus, the total sample consisted of 100 participants.

During data collection, the main researcher filled in the two research instruments, Characterization of the child and the Caregiver Burden Scale (Zarit Burden Interview), according to the participants’ answers, which were followed up by screen projection.

This scale was translated into Portuguese in 2002 and consists of 22 items covering the domains of health, social and personal life, financial situation, emotional well-being and interpersonal relationships. Each item on the scale is scored (0: never, 1: rarely, 2: sometimes, 3: often and 4: always) and the total score can vary from 0 to 88 points. After adding up the points, the bands correspond to the following overloads: none (0-21), mild (21-40), moderate (41-60) and severe (61-88).(1414. Scazufca M. Data was collected online on days and times previously agreed for the interview (Google Meet®). On the day of the interview, before starting the recording, the participants were given the Informed Consent Form(ICF) for electronic acceptance (Google Forms®) and the Assignment of Use of image and voice.

The data collected was exported to the Statistical Package for Social Sciences (SPSS; v. 23), where it was analyzed. At this stage, the means of the dependent variable (ZBI) were calculated in relation to each level of exposure to the independent variables.

The dependent variables in the study were as follows: physical, emotional and social overload of primary caregivers of children with congenital heart disease, classified as categorical; absent, moderate, moderate-severe and severe overload. The variables in the characterization tool were the independent variables related to the children: age (in years or months), gender, name of congenital heart disease, follow-up in a health unit specializing in cardiology, use of continuous medication, cardiac surgery, hospitalization in the last 12 months of life, time since diagnosis of heart disease, association with another disease, attendance at nursery or school and receipt of some social benefit.

The analyses were carried out using descriptive statistics. Mean, median and standard deviation (SD) were calculated for the quantitative variables. The qualitative variables were described using absolute (n) and relative (%) frequencies. To carry out the bivariate and multivariate analyses, the normality of the data distribution was first tested (Shapiro-Wilk test). After confirming that the study variables followed a normal distribution, parametric statistics were used. The bivariate analyses were based on analysis of variance (one-way ANOVA) applied to categorical variables.

Multivariate analysis was carried out using multiple linear regression. The multivariate model included all the variables that showed statistical significance (p≤0.10) in the bivariate analysis. All variables that showed an association with the outcome remained in the multivariate model (significance level: 5%; p≤0.05). The quality of fit of the multivariate models was assessed by the R-squared (R2) and F-statistic measures.

Results

A total of 100 mothers caring for children with congenital heart disease took part in the study. The burden of these caregiver mothers was assessed for mean score (34.5), standard deviation (12.5) and minimum (8.0) and maximum (63.0) scores. Table 1 shows the bivariate analysis between the characteristics of affected children and the caregiver burden scores of children with heart disease. After categorical analysis, the majority of primary caregivers had a mild burden (Table 2).

In terms of gender, the children with congenital heart disease were divided into boys (58%) and girls (42%). The average age of the children was 47.2 months, or 3.9 years (SD: 3.2), most of whom (59%) were between pre-school age and infants (1-5 years) and more than half did not attend school or nursery (60%). Congenital heart diseases were classified according to blood flow, as cyanotic and acyanotic, and may be associated with more than one heart disease in the same child. In the children in this study, the most frequent were cyanotic (51%). In terms of time since diagnosis, 86% of the children had been diagnosed for more than a year. It was observed that 96% of the children were under specialized follow-up in a cardiology unit (or with a cardiologist) and 55% of them were taking continuous medication specifically for the treatment of congenital heart disease. As for heart surgery, 49% had at least one and 30% had two or more. With regard to hospital admissions in the last 12 months, more than half (56%) did not require hospitalization. Children with comorbidities made up 47% of the sample, i.e. 47 children were diagnosed with a disease other than congenital heart disease. The assessment of the level of burden of primary caregivers of children with congenital heart disease, considering the total score of the scale, showed an average value of 34.5, standard deviation: 12.5; minimum and maximum scores of 9 and 63 points, respectively. Thus, 17% of the caregivers were classified as having no burden, while others were classified as having mild (54%), moderate (26%) and severe (3%) burdens (Table 2).

Multivariate linear regression showed that children’s age (p=0.881), time since diagnosis (p=0.708) and having had heart surgery (p=0.116) were not significantly associated with the caregiver burden scale. In other words, they cannot be considered predictors of the burden assessed. On the other hand, specialized care (p=0.003), the presence of comorbidities (p=0.0001) and attending daycare or school (p=0.001) were significantly associated and could be considered predictors of caregiver burden (Table 3). Specialized health care increases the chances of caregiver burden by 14.2 times (95%CI=4.94-23.33) compared to children who do not receive it. A similar analysis can be made in relation to the presence of comorbidities, as children who have other comorbidities can increase the chances of caregiver burden by 8.23 times (95%CI=3.83-12.63) when compared to children without comorbidities. Finally, attending school or daycare increases the odds of primary caregiver burden by 7.61 times (95%CI=3.17-12.06). With regard to the quality of the model’s fit, it is worth mentioning that the F-statistic proved to be more robust to testing the overall significance of the regression model (F=10.9; p<0.001) in model 2 when compared to model 1 (F=5.94; p<0.001). The R2 values ranged from 0.25 (in the full model) to 0.28 (in the final model), showing that the reduction in the number of variables for a simpler model was pertinent.

The complexity of the treatment and the special care imposed by CHD changes the family routine and directly impacts the personal and professional lives of primary caregivers. In this study, most of the children (96%) had been diagnosed with congenital heart disease for more than a year, with the need for specialized health monitoring and the use of heart disease medication. This has an impact on the routine of primary caregivers, who may find it difficult to keep their jobs while caring for and attending to the schedule of appointments, exams, hospitalization and ensuring medication care, as they need to accompany the children to medical appointments and exams.(2020. With primary caregivers leaving the job market, financial resources in the family are restricted. Even for CCCs who receive social benefits, the money is used only for treating the children, reducing family income and impacting on quality of life. This hinders access to good food and better health, housing and leisure conditions, leading families into a critical financial situation, thus contributing to a moderate burden on primary caregivers.(2020. The same was shown in a Brazilian study that assessed the burden of caregivers of children with cerebral palsy in relation to school attendance. The lower level of motor impairment seems to indicate greater school participation by these children. A counterpoint was presented in relation to the burden of these caregivers, as the burden of caregivers of children with milder motor impairments was greater than that of caregivers of children with more severe motor impairments. One possible explanation was the fact that children with milder impairments have greater independence and participation in social life. Thus, it is possible to infer that these factors can generate frustration and anguish in family members, increasing their emotional burden.(1414. Scazufca M. With regard to the use of specific drugs for heart disease, most children use them, which is common for treating symptoms and avoiding complications of heart disease. However, the choice of medication to treat congenital heart disease depends on the type of heart disease and its hemodynamic changes. They can be platelet antiaggregant (for the pre- and postoperative periods), antiarrhythmics (to control arrhythmia), diuretics, antihypertensives, etc.(3333. Cesario MS, Carneiro AM, Dolabela MF. A European study found that among children with congenital heart disease, the use of cardiovascular medication indicates greater cardiac and circulatory impairment; when medication needs to be prescribed, it happens in the first few years of life. Diuretics and antihypertensive drugs are the most commonly used.(3434. Damkjaer M, Urhoj SK, Tan J, Briggs G, Loane M, Given JE, et al. In this study, three relevant factors were associated with the outcome of caregiver burden. These were: the presence of comorbidities, specialized monitoring and attending daycare or school.

The presence of comorbidities was likely to increase caregiver burden by 8.23 points. We understand that care demands are greater in the presence of comorbidities. In a study carried out in Sao Paulo on children with special health needs with different chronic conditions, caregivers were 26.2% more likely to be overburdened when the children had mixed care demands.(1010. Children with heart disease who are undergoing specialized health care often require long hospital stays, including intensive care units, specific tests and surgical procedures. This factor is closely related to stress and psychological damage for parents. During the treatment process, mothers feel vulnerable and alone, with fear, anxiety and depression. Studies show that families of CRIANES are financially overburdened, as many families live far away from the treatment unit and have to pay for travel and food on the days of consultations and examinations needed by the children. The need to reshape daily life can increase the burden.(4343. Kasparian NA, Kan JM, Sood E, Wray J, Pincus HA, Newburger JW. The limitations of this study are related to the sample size due to changes in the data collection strategy during the COVID-19 pandemic, which forced online interviews to be conducted. Another possible limitation would be selection bias, as the data was only collected from caregivers of children with congenital heart disease who belonged to a specific group on an online social network. This may have excluded other overburdened caregivers who were unable to access the internet, including economic or geographical conditions. Given the limitations of this study in establishing cause and effect relationships, it is important to develop new studies with a longitudinal design.

Conclusion

In the correlation between the characteristics of children with congenital heart disease and the level of burden of their primary caregivers, being under specialized care, having comorbidities and attending school or daycare are characteristics that increase the burden of their caregivers, although it is identified as mild.
